Every year, AARP hosts our Life@50+ National Event and Expo in a different city. The impact of our event is substantial for the host city with attendees spending significantly at local hotels, restaurants, attractions and other businesses. In 2011, Life@50+ wanted to broaden that impact by volunteering time and resources to areas of the host city that aren’t always visible to our event attendees.
On Wednesday, Sept. 21, 2011, the day before the official start of the 2011 Life@50+ event, AARP volunteers partnered with award-winning chefs to go into six soup kitchens and rescue missions on Skid
Row in downtown Los Angeles. They prepared, served and ate a meal with residents and guests.
Los Angeles’ Skid Row contains one of the largest stable populations of homeless persons in the United States. As of the census of 2000, there were 17,740 people residing in this neighborhood, which is concentrated in a few small blocks in the city. Operating throughout Skid Row are non-profit organizations dedicated to helping those in need. Each facility or mission provides the homeless men, women and children of Los Angeles with services that range from walk-in medical care, beds, hot meals and showers to rehabilitation services, halfway houses and job placement assistance.
